Transaction 595e34797caab767b3aff17940bc3ac873a1ec6e8dea8ab6397b32990d5cbcfe
1 Input
1 Output
-
595e34797caab767b3aff17940bc3ac873a1ec6e8dea8ab6397b32990d5cbcfe:0
- value
- 624336
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 881375bf951abaa257faa68d81d309a31025f536 OP_EQUAL
- address
- 3E6X8jXZHpbPmWs9tD8xjxZ9zeCHzkKkb8